The New York Roma / Gypsy Human Rights Film Festival continues to roam the globe to present you with an in depth and diverse view on the lives of some of the world’s most overlooked and undervalued people. In a full and varied program we bring together filmmakers, musicians and artists for a spirited and lively celebration of the Roma people.

The festival will screen over 33 films from all over the world: Czech Republic, Germany, Bulgaria, England, Serbia, Italy, Hungary, Netherlands, Romania, Canada and Turkey, including many world premiers and American debuts. Q&A’s and panel discussions featuring the filmmakers, invited artists, lecturers and musicians offer you the opportunity to engage face to face.

The Festival proudly presents special programs featuring:

• The Gypsy Holocaust, breaking the silence of a decades’ long taboo with movies and lectures and debates with The Honorable Ian F. Hancock, Director of The Romani Archives and Documentation Center and former Roma representative to the UN Economic and Social Council And Member of the International Romani Parliament. Ian Hancock (Professor at the University of Texas) and Michael Stewart (Professor at the University College London) on the current situation of Gypsies in North America and the persecution and genocide of Gypsies in Europe

• A lecture by Roma advocate Boglarka Fedorko on contemporary Hungary

• OutSide Film event including the screening of the banned Bulgarian cult film ‘Bakalava’

• ‘Our Garbage Dump, our Hell and Heaven’, a new play by Ella Veres, set in a Gypsy community in Romania.

European electors vote in right wing ‘anti Roma’ parties, acting as racist attacks that target Roma populations from Ireland to Italy, Hungary to Romania; even the smallest children suffer from structural segregation and abuse. After centuries of slavery, genocide, massacres and relentless ostracizing the Roma, presently numbering around 15 million people worldwide, continue to be subjected to unprecedented levels of discrimination and violence in today’s world.

STILL HOPE FOR SULUKULE!

Tags:

Last summer, GB visited the oldest Rom settlement in the world: Sulukule in Istanbul, Turkey (you can read more about the visit here ).

Despite a thousand-year heritage, authorities are allowing the destruction of Sulukule to make way for a brand new building development. Check out the more recent photos…

Sulukule Sulukule Sulukule Sulukule

However, there is still hope!

The pressures by the local and international media and institutions, including the threat of UNESCO about taking Istanbul out of the World Heritage List due to the violations against conventions, raised an interest in the alternative efforts spent by the volunteers of the STOP project.

In June 2009, the president of TOKI invited the volunteers of the STOP project to Ankara in order to present it. Upon this request representatives of the volunteers had a meeting with TOKI in Ankara and explained the main approach of the project. TOKI asked the volunteers to revise the project in one month time according to the current situation of the neighborhood, which was demolished almost entirely by then. After the meeting, a new workshop (Sulukule Studio), initially consisted of Sulukule Platform and Solidarity Atelier but open to any participation and support, has started to work on the alternative project. At the moment, this workshop is in full progress for an alternative plan that aims to regain the housing rights of Sulukule residents and minimize the damage that has been caused so far. The initial decisions were shared with a larger public and the media in two meetings and a huge support was received.

As the volunteers of the alternative project, we would like to make an urgent call to the concerned institutions to give their support at this critical period in order to encourage TOKI to consider the alternative project seriously. REMEMBRANCE

Tags:

International Remembrance Day for Roma Victims of the Porrajmos (Holocaust) is on August 2nd.

On this day in 1944, thousands of Roma were gassed in Auschwitz-Birkenau. Jewish survivors said the sky was lit up all night by the crematory burning, and "the women were fighting for the life of their children". On August 3rd, Auschwitz–Birkenau was "Zigeunerfrei" (Free of Gypsies).

Romani groups have begun an international action day: ‘Together against Antigypsyism’.
